  • Patent number: 10531536
    Abstract: An optoelectronic assembly and method for operating an optoelectronic assembly are provided. In some aspects, the optoelectronic assembly includes an organic light-emitting component, a temperature sensor configured to record a temperature value, and a driver circuit coupled to the organic light-emitting component and the temperature sensor. The driver circuit is configured to apply an AC voltage to the organic light-emitting component when the organic light-emitting component is switched on, and if the recorded temperature value is less than a predetermined temperature threshold value, where the AC voltage is, at least, temporarily less than an instantaneous threshold voltage of the organic light-emitting component. The driver circuit is also configured to apply a DC voltage to the organic light-emitting component if a measurement value is greater than or equal to a predetermined threshold value, where the DC voltage is greater than the instantaneous threshold voltage of the organic light-emitting component.

  • Patent number: 10090365
    Abstract: An organic device is disclosed. In an embodiment the organic device includes an organic component designed to emit and/or detect radiation, wherein the organic component has a first layer stack and a radiation passage surface and an organic protection diode having a second layer stack, wherein the organic protection diode is arranged directly after the organic component in a stacking direction (Z), and wherein the organic protection diode is designed to protect the organic component from an electrostatic discharge and/or from a polarity reversal of the organic component.

  • Patent number: 10084158
    Abstract: The invention relates to an optoelectronic component (100) comprising an organic light emitting diode (1) designed for emitting radiation and/or heat, a substrate (2), on which the organic light emitting diode is arranged, wherein the substrate (2) comprises a first substrate material (21) and at least one substrate cavity (22) which is filled with a second substrate material (23) different than the first substrate material (21), wherein the second substrate material (23) is designed to dissipate the heat emitted by the organic light emitting diode (1).
